Cover photo: The Hoka-hoko float, a cherished symbol of local pride in Kyoto’s Gion Matsuri with its majestic presence and striking tapestry featuring two owls. "Hoka," a Zen term, conveys the idea of casting everything aside to enter a state of selflessness and detachment. This spiritual meaning embodies both the community's devotion and the deeper philosophical roots of the festival.
